Easy to Learn:

Python is intended for novice users. Completing basic tasks requires less Python code than other languages. Code is usually 3-5 times shorter than Java and 5-10 times smaller than C++. Python code is easy to read, and new developers with little knowledge can learn a lot by looking at the code.
